A flat spot just off the road, where two rivers confluence. Thanks to their hum there is almost no street noise. Thus it is quiet and calm.
Looks like a place where river stones and sand are loaded on trucks.
Probably possible to camp in a tent after finding a dry spot as most of the flat terrain is wet or slightly muddy. No problem for rigs though, even big ones.
